Hart, John

Hart, John, 1711?–1779, political leader in the American Revolution, signer of the Declaration of Independence, b. Hopewell Township, N.J. A prosperous farm and mill owner, he was a member of the provincial assembly (1761–71), of several provincial congresses, and of the Continental Congress of 1776. See biography by C. E. Hammond (1977).
